Single Burning Item (SBI) Tester — ToronFT™ SBI

ToronFT™ SBI Single Burning Item Tester is a large-scale fire performance testing instrument designed for the determination of fire response properties of building materials and products (excluding flooring materials) using the Single Burning Item (SBI) test method specified by the European Construction Products Regulation (EC Decision 2000/147/EC). The SBI test subjects full-scale specimens of building materials or products to thermal attack from a single burning item in a corner-geometry combustion chamber, evaluating heat release rate, smoke production, and lateral flame spread — the three key fire parameters used to classify building products under EN 13501-1.

The SBI test is a cornerstone of the European fire classification system for construction products, and the ToronFT™ SBI provides the precisely controlled combustion chamber geometry, gas collection hood, and measurement systems required for accurate, repeatable, and standard-compliant SBI test results.

Single Burning Item (SBI) Tester

Standards

The ToronFT™ SBI supports single burning item testing in compliance with internationally recognized fire performance standards, including:

  • EN 13823: Reaction to fire tests for building products — Building products excluding floorings exposed to the thermal attack by a single burning item
  • EN 13501-1: Fire classification of construction products and building elements — Classification using data from reaction to fire tests
  • ISO 9705: Fire tests — Full-scale room test for surface products (reference method for SBI calibration)
  • EC Decision 2000/147/EC: Implementing Council Directive 89/106/EEC (Construction Products Directive — fire classification system)

Theory and Method

The SBI test mounts the test specimens as two perpendicular wings (long wing and short wing) forming a corner in the combustion chamber. A propane burner (the single burning item) applies a defined heat exposure at the base of the corner junction. The heat released by the specimen combustion, together with smoke produced, rises through the combustion chamber and exits through the gas collection hood and smoke exhaust pipe at the top of the room. Thermocouples, oxygen, CO, and CO₂ analyzers in the exhaust duct measure the heat release rate, total heat release, and smoke production rate throughout the test.

The combustion chamber dimensions — (3.0±0.2) m × (3.0±0.2) m × (2.4±0.1) m — provide the standardized corner-exposure geometry. The long wing test surface in contact with the U-shaped slot and the quality inspection surface of the chamber wall must be (2.1±0.1) m apart (vertical distance). The chamber has one opening for air intake (0.05 m² total — the combined areas of the air inlet at the trolley bottom and the smoke exhaust of the air collection hood), and observation windows on both the long wing and short wing walls for specimen monitoring. A closable door on one side facilitates post-test chamber cleaning.

Single Burning Item (SBI) Tester — ToronFT™ SBI Technical Specifications

Component / ParameterSpecification Details
General Information
ModelToronFT™ SBI
Test MethodSingle Burning Item (SBI) — EN 13823
Standard ComplianceEN 13823; EN 13501-1; EC Decision 2000/147/EC
Combustion Chamber & Footprint
Chamber Dimensions (L×W×H)(3.0±0.2) m × (3.0±0.2) m × (2.4±0.1) m
Overall System FootprintApprox. 6 × 7 × 6 m
Chamber Wall ConstructionBrick walls
Chamber Opening Area0.05 m² (excluding trolley bottom air inlet and hood exhaust)
Observation WindowsLocated on the long wing wall and short wing wall
Access OpeningsTrolley Access: 1470 mm × 2450 mm (W×H)
Post-Test Access: Closable door on one side
Specimen Configuration
GeometryLong wing + short wing (corner geometry, L-type installation)
Specimen DimensionsLong wing: 1.5 m; Short wing: 1.0 m
ClearanceLong wing to wall vertical distance: (2.1±0.1) m
Fuel & Exhaust System
FuelPropane (≥95%)
Heat Release30.7±2.0 kW
Mass Flow ControlRange: 0–2.5 g/s; Accuracy: ±1%
Exhaust SystemFlow rate: 0.50–0.65 m³/s; Pipe: J-type pipe Ø315 mm
Gas Analysis & Measurement
O₂ Gas AnalysisRange: 0–25%; Accuracy: ±0.1%
CO₂ Gas AnalysisRange: 0–10%; Accuracy: ±2% FS (Full Scale)
Temperature MeasurementRange: 0–400°C; Accuracy: ±0.5°C
Smoke Density MeasurementTransmittance: 0–100%; Accuracy: ±1%
Data Acquisition & Results
Data Acquisition RateRecording every 3 seconds; Time accuracy: 0.1s
Key Results GeneratedTHR600s, FIGRA, heat release rate, smoke density, etc.
